French window replacement services involve removing old or damaged French windows and installing new ones that match the style and specifications of the property. This process typically includes measuring the existing openings, choosing suitable window styles, and ensuring proper fitting and sealing. The goal is to improve the appearance of the property while enhancing functionality, whether that means better insulation, easier operation, or updated aesthetics. Local contractors experienced in French window replacement can handle everything from small residential homes to larger multi-story properties, making sure the new windows are installed securely and efficiently.

Many property owners turn to French window replacement services when existing windows are no longer performing well or have become a source of issues. Common problems include drafts, difficulty opening or closing, broken or cracked glass, or frames that have warped over time. Replacing French windows can help address these issues, providing better insulation to reduce energy costs, improving security, and restoring the overall look of the home. It’s also a practical solution for those wanting to update older properties with modern, energy-efficient windows that still retain a classic, elegant appearance.

This service is often used in a variety of property types, including single-family homes, historic residences, and even some commercial buildings. French windows are popular in properties that feature traditional or period architecture, where maintaining the aesthetic is important. They are also common in homes with gardens, patios, or balconies, as they provide a charming way to connect indoor living spaces with outdoor areas. The overview below groups typical French Window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Waco, TX.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or French window repairs in the Waco area range from $250 to $600. Many routine fixes, such as replacing hardware or resealing, fall within this range. Fewer projects tend to push into higher cost tiers unless additional work is required.

Standard Replacement - Replacing existing French windows with new units generally costs between $1,200 and $3,000 per window. Most projects in this category are straightforward installations handled by local contractors. Larger or more custom replacements can reach $4,000 or more per window.

Full Installation of Multiple Units - Installing several French windows in a single project typically ranges from $5,000 to $15,000 total. Many homes opt for mid-range options, while larger or more complex projects involving custom features can exceed this range.

Complex or Custom Projects - Larger, more intricate French window replacements or custom designs can cost $20,000+ depending on size, materials, and scope. These projects are less common and usually involve specialized features or high-end materials handled by experienced local pros.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are French windows? French windows are large, double-pane glass doors that typically open outward or inward, providing a stylish way to connect indoor and outdoor spaces.

Can French window replacements improve home security? Yes, many service providers offer French window options with enhanced locking mechanisms and durable materials to help improve security.

Are there different styles of French windows available? Local contractors often provide a variety of styles, including traditional, contemporary, and custom designs to match different home aesthetics.

What materials are commonly used for French window replacements? Common materials include wood, vinyl, and aluminum, each offering different benefits in terms of durability and appearance.
